Some
Films featuring Alarmel Valli
In 1982, a
film on Alarmél Valli was made for the
Omnibus series, on BBC 2 by the director, Michael
Macintyre for ‘The India Festival’
in London in 1983. In 2004 The Films Division
of India commissioned a film on her for the
Indian National Archives. Titled ‘Pravahi’,
it has been directed by eminent film-maker Arun
Khopkar, with cinematography by Madhu Ambat.
Alarmél
Valli has also been featured in dance documentaries
by noted Indian producers like the late G. Aravindan
and Prakash Jha, by the BBC (in The Spirit of
Asia Series), the Nederlands Broadcasting Company,
Arte (France) and Japanese National Television.
She has been documented for the archives of
the Sangeet Natak Academy -the apex body for
Music, Dance and Drama in India. Along with
her Guru, Pandanallur Shri. Subbaraya Pillai,
she has been interviewed and filmed by the (IGNCA)
Indira Gandhi National Centre for Arts.
